Why Dental Cleanings Matter

Even with excellent oral hygiene at home, some areas of your mouth can be hard to reach. Over time, plaque can harden into tartar, a substance that can only be removed by a dental professional. Without regular cleanings, this buildup may lead to:

What to Expect During Your Cleaning

We believe prevention is the most powerful tool in dentistry. Professional dental cleanings not only keep your smile bright but also protect against cavities, gum disease, and other oral health concerns. By combining thorough cleanings with personalized home care guidance, we help ensure your teeth and gums stay healthy year-round.

Oral Exam

A quick check for signs of decay, gum inflammation, or other issues.

Plaque and Tartar Removal

Using specialized instruments, your hygienist will gently remove buildup from your teeth, especially around the gum line and between teeth.

Deep Cleaning and Polishing

Your teeth will be brushed with a high-powered electric tool and polished to remove surface stains and leave your smile shining.

Flossing and Rinse

Professional flossing ensures no debris is left behind, followed by a refreshing rinse.
